Opatija walking tour: Pearl of the Adriatic in 90 minutesA 90-minute walking tour of Opatija led by a local guide in English, German or Croatian, starting at Opatija Harbor. You walk the scenic promenade past mansions and gardens, visit the abbey church that named the town, see the first hotel on the Adriatic coast, and discover the Croatian Walk of Fame alongside one of the largest beaches. The guide explains how Opatija transformed from a modest village into the "Pearl of the Adriatic" and the cradle of Croatian tourism.Is it for me?The 90-minute walk moves at a moderate pace through town streets and the seaside promenade, so you'll need comfortable shoes and a moderate level of fitness — it suits anyone who wants to understand Opatija's history without a full-day commitment.
